testing isolinux boot
I'm testing the cdrom image from
http://people.debian.org/~hertzog/debian-cd/woody-isolinux.iso
Dell Dimension XPS R400, PII/400
boots to prompt fine.
recbf24 finds my disks, then can't find init. init= option to it is ignored.
rescue and rescvanl can't find my root disk.
"bf24 init=/bin/sh" boots, but seems even more confused than I think it
should be. Mount needs the "-t ext3" option to mount anything, and umount
fails. This is probably a case of my expectations being wrong, and I think
I could use this to rescue a broken system if needed.
